Brain teasers have a sweet spot when it comes to spending time constructively. Brain teasers are generally considered beneficial for both cognitive and mental well-being. They can improve cognitive skills like problem-solving, memory, and concentration, while also offering psychological benefits like stress reduction and enhanced mindfulness. 

Brain teasers challenge you to think critically and find creative solutions, enhancing your problem-solving abilities. The process of recalling information and forming connections while solving puzzles strengthens neural pathways and improves memory function. 

Focusing on a brain teaser requires sustained attention, which can help improve your overall concentration and focus. Brain teasers stimulate various cognitive functions, including reasoning, lateral thinking, and spatial reasoning. 

Engaging in brain teasers can provide a mental escape from daily worries, helping to reduce stress and anxiety. The focused attention required for solving puzzles can promote mindfulness and a sense of calm. 

Successfully solving a brain teaser can release dopamine, a neurotransmitter associated with boosting pleasure and reward, which in turn leads to a boost in mood.

Children, adults, and older people—all of them can benefit from brain teasers. Brain teasers can be a fun and engaging way for children to learn and develop their cognitive skills.

Studies suggest that regular puzzle-solving can help delay the onset of cognitive decline and potentially reduce the risk of dementia.
